Get started17 Cromwell Road is a detached house in Bramhall, Stockport, Stockport (SK7 1DA). It has a recorded floor area of 174 m² (around 1873 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(May 2012) returns a B (score 82), comfortably above the UK average. The latest certificate is from May 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Held since December 1998 — that's 27 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. At 174 m² the property is well over the postcode median (117 m² across 15 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 87%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£683,000 sits 326.9% above the 1998 sale of £160,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£85/sq ft) was about 71.9% below the postcode norm.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
